lessening with time

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"lessening with time"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a gradual decrease or reduction of something as time passes. Example: "The pain from the injury is lessening with time, making it easier for me to move around."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

Use "lessening with time" to describe processes or feelings that diminish naturally as time passes. For instance, "The initial shock of the news is lessening with time, allowing me to process it more rationally."

Common error

Avoid using "lessening with time" when describing situations requiring immediate action. This phrase implies a gradual decrease, not a quick fix. For example, instead of saying "The danger is lessening with time", when a fire is spreading, focus on calling the fire department to contain the issue.

FAQs

How can I use "lessening with time" in a sentence?

You can use "lessening with time" to describe a gradual decrease in intensity or impact as time passes. For example, "The pain from the surgery is "lessening with time"."

What are some alternatives to "lessening with time"?

Alternatives include "diminishing over time", "decreasing as time goes on", or "fading with the passage of time", depending on the specific nuance you want to convey.

Is it appropriate to use "lessening with time" in formal writing?

Yes, "lessening with time" is appropriate in formal writing. However, consider using more sophisticated alternatives like "abating as time elapses" if a more elevated tone is desired.

What's the difference between "lessening with time" and "improving with time"?

"Lessening with time" suggests a decrease in something negative, while "improving with time" indicates a positive change or betterment. For instance, "The severity of the symptoms is "lessening with time"", versus "My understanding of the subject is "improving with time"".
